🏛️ Capito dumps Apple, CEG; Broadcom gov contracts hit $18M

Capito dumped Apple, Constellation Energy, and Broadcom last week while AAPL sat in overbought territory. Her Broadcom exit came the same quarter government contracts to the company hit $18M, up from $5.6M last quarter. That's a 200% jump while she's walking away from the stock.
